Song Of The Day #764
Ranch Radio's Western Swing Week continues with Cliff Bruner's Texas Wanderers performing Can't Nobody Truck Like Me.
The tune was recorded in San Antonio on Feb. 5, 1937 and was released as Decca 5337. Band members for this session were: Cliff Bruner, fiddle; Dick McBride, vocals and guitar; Randall Raley, vocals and guitar; Joe Thames, banjo; Leo Raley, vocals and mandolin; Russell Bryant, base; Fred Calhoun, piano
